Top 5 Online Grocery Shopping Sites in the UK

Online grocery shopping has become a major trend in the UK. A recent study conducted by HIM and Spryker discovered that nearly two thirds of Brits are now shopping for their food online.

Many supermarkets provide a Click and Collect service where you can choose an hour-long time frame to pick up the groceries. Some, like Tesco, have no minimum spending requirements. Some price match Aldi to ensure you get the best price.

Morrisons

Morrisons is one of the oldest and largest supermarket chains. It is renowned for its low prices and excellent customer service, and has taken steps to simplify and speed up its business and scale for growth. It has also invested in new technology to improve efficiency, including digitised shelf labels that allow for automated pricing, and a mobile application that allows staff to quickly update stock levels. It also has a partnership with Ocado to provide online grocery shopping.

Its stores feature a Market Street concept with specialty shops, like butchers and fishmongers, as well as American shops that sell doughnuts as well as hotdogs. This is a significant differentiation for the company since it helps to attract suburban customers. Morrisons also owns its own production facilities which allows it to keep prices down and remain profitable.

Morrisons home delivery service saves time and money because you don’t have to drive to the store or navigate through crowded parking spaces. You can also easily track your spending when you add items to your virtual shopping cart. This can aid you in sticking to your budget and avoid spending too much.

Morrisons’ loyalty scheme is dubbed “Morrisons More.” It rewards customers with PS5 vouchers (called Fivers) for every 500 points they accumulate. The vouchers are redeemable in-store or via the internet. The program differs from other supermarket loyalty schemes in that you are able to redeem points for Morrisons products and services, rather than for treats like days out or vouchers for restaurants. Morrisons More can be joined via their app or website. It is free to join and comes with a two-step verification process for security.

Asda

ASDA is one of the biggest supermarket chains in the United Kingdom. It has a wide range of goods, ranging including food and drink, homewares and clothing. The stores also offer services such as opticians and pharmacies. The company was founded as Associated Dairies and Farm Stores in 1949 and has its headquarters in Leeds. In addition to providing high-quality products at a reasonable price, ASDA is dedicated to employee growth and well-being. This includes a variety of training programs and opportunities for career advancement. Its commitment to customer satisfaction has greatly contributed to its expansion and success.

ASDA’s online shopping delivery service helps save customers time and money by removing the need to travel to a supermarket. This convenience is especially useful for busy individuals who juggle multiple obligations and have limited time. ASDA’s mobile app and its website are user-friendly, allowing customers to search for specific items and receive personalized recommendations based on their previous purchases.

The website of ASDA offers a greater range of products than physical stores. Customers can get the best price on their most-loved products and brands, saving both time and money. ASDA’s online delivery service is also accessible 24/7, allowing busy schedules to be accommodated.

ASDA’s online grocery delivery service lets customers purchase and order items at any time, which reduces their carbon footprint. Additionally, the service offers many delivery options that include same-day and next-day delivery. The service can also deliver products to any UK address including work and residential addresses.
